Browse Source

Set

pull/3/head
Jure Šorn 5 years ago
parent
commit
b16ccc6987
1 changed files with 13 additions and 10 deletions
  1. 23
      README.md

23
README.md

@ -16,8 +16,11 @@ List
---- ----
```python ```python
<list>[from_inclusive : to_exclusive : step_size] <list>[from_inclusive : to_exclusive : step_size]
<list>.append(<el>)
<list>.extend(<list>)
<list>.append(<el>) # Same as <list> += [<el>]
<list>.extend(<list>) # Same as <list> += <list>
```
```python
<list>.sort() <list>.sort()
<list>.reverse() <list>.reverse()
<list> = sorted(<list>) <list> = sorted(<list>)
@ -87,10 +90,10 @@ Set
``` ```
```python ```python
<set> = <set>.union(<set>)
<set> = <set>.intersection(<set>)
<set> = <set>.difference(<set>)
<set> = <set>.symmetric_difference(<set>)
<set> = <set>.union(<set>) # Same as <set> | <set>
<set> = <set>.intersection(<set>) # Same as <set> & <set>
<set> = <set>.difference(<set>) # Same as <set> - <set>
<set> = <set>.symmetric_difference(<set>) # Same as <set> ^ <set>
<bool> = <set>.issubset(<set>) <bool> = <set>.issubset(<set>)
<bool> = <set>.issuperset(<set>) <bool> = <set>.issuperset(<set>)
``` ```
@ -561,9 +564,9 @@ class <enum_name>(Enum):
``` ```
```python ```python
list(<enum>) # == [<member_1>, <member_2>, ...]
list(a.name for a in <enum>) # == ['<member_name_1>', '<member_name_2>', ...]
random.choice(list(<enum>)) # == random <member>
list(<enum>) # == [<member_1>, <member_2>, ...]
[a.name for a in <enum>] # == ['<member_name_1>', '<member_name_2>', ...]
random.choice(list(<enum>)) # == random <member>
``` ```
### Inline ### Inline
@ -1207,7 +1210,7 @@ duration = time() - start_time
#### Times execution of the passed code: #### Times execution of the passed code:
```python ```python
from timeit import timeit from timeit import timeit
timeit('"-".join(str(n) for n in range(100))', number=1000000, , globals=globals())
timeit('"-".join(str(n) for n in range(100))', number=1000000, globals=globals())
``` ```
#### Generates a PNG image of call graph and highlights the bottlenecks: #### Generates a PNG image of call graph and highlights the bottlenecks:

Loading…
Cancel
Save